Output 83d0761039e48187429e5114206c2ebabe11d7acf517c3e626abeef5473346bb:1

value
4430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180904bdc47106f66de851b7aebe657734f4b88b OP_EQUAL
address
33t6wmMLMzSp9AB5LGNZPayQL28t5Vc4U2
transaction
83d0761039e48187429e5114206c2ebabe11d7acf517c3e626abeef5473346bb
spent
true